CN-224203696-U - Automatic reader for self-made CPC card of toll station
Abstract
The utility model provides a self-made CPC card automatic reader for a toll station, which relates to the technical field of card readers and comprises a vertical block, a frame, a bracket, a placing platform and a collecting box, wherein the inner side of the frame is rotationally connected with a driven shaft, one side of the frame is fixedly provided with a motor, the output end of the motor is fixedly provided with a driving shaft, and the outer walls of the driving shaft and the driven shaft are sleeved with a conveying belt. According to the utility model, the continuous automatic transmission and reading of CPC cards are realized by the cooperation of the motor driving shaft, the motor driven shaft and the conveyor belt and the cooperative work of the structures such as the placement frame and the collection box, so that manual sheet-by-sheet operation is not needed, the inventory time is greatly shortened, a large amount of manual investment is reduced, the pressure of the shortage of the productivity of a base toll station is effectively relieved, the inventory work efficiency of thousands of sheets per month is greatly improved, meanwhile, by adopting a homemade design, compared with the automatic card reader of each of two ten thousand yuan to one hundred thousand yuan on the market, the equipment cost is obviously reduced, and the CPC card is suitable for batch allocation of base toll stations.

Automatic reader for self-made CPC card of toll station Technical Field The utility model relates to the technical field of card readers, in particular to a self-made CPC card automatic card reader for a toll station. Background The national expressway is converted from original weight charging to vehicle type charging, the traffic cards used in MTC lanes are converted from IC cards to CPC cards, and according to the related requirements of operation manuals of national CPC card management platforms and compound traffic card (CPC card) station-level management systems, all-level card management institutions need to clean and check the stock CPC cards every day and every month to form the latest stock data. At present, most of all-level card management mechanisms conduct manual card reading operation one by one in the checking work, the time and the efficiency are low, a large amount of labor is consumed, the market price of the existing automatic card reader in the market is different from that of the existing automatic card reader in two tens of thousands of yuan, the automatic card reader is difficult to be equipped and popularized in basic toll booths, but the checking amount of thousands of cards per month makes basic layers with short productivity overwhelm, and therefore improvement is needed. Disclosure of utility model The utility model aims to solve the problems in the background art, and provides a self-made CPC card automatic reader for a toll station. In order to achieve the aim, the automatic card reader for the self-made CPC card in the toll station adopts the following technical scheme that the automatic card reader comprises a vertical block, a frame, a support, a placing platform and a collecting box, wherein the inner side of the frame is rotationally connected with a driven shaft, one side of the frame is fixedly provided with a motor, the output end of the motor is fixedly provided with a driving shaft, the driving shaft and the outer wall of the driven shaft are sleeved with a conveying belt, one side, close to the motor, of the frame is fixedly provided with a speed controller, the top of the placing platform is provided with a card reader body, and the inner side of the top of the support is fixedly provided with a placing frame. Preferably, the driving shaft and the driven shaft are both in rotary connection with the conveyor belt. Here, through the rotation connection of conveyer belt and driving shaft, driven shaft, can form stable transmission system, ensure that CPC card keeps continuous, at the uniform velocity removal in the conveying process, avoid blocking or skidding to improve card reader body and read accuracy and efficiency to card information. Preferably, the motor is electrically connected with the speed controller. Here, the speed controller can adjust the rotational speed of motor in real time to the operating speed of control conveyer belt, through nimble speed adjustment, adaptable different grade type CPC card's reading demand avoids leading to the card reader body to miss the reading or the speed is too slow to influence the passing efficiency because of the speed is too fast. Preferably, the stand is located at the bottom of the frame, and the stand is fixedly connected with the frame. Here, the stability of the use of the in-frame delivery assembly is improved by the fixed connection.
